City of Palm Desert

City of Palm Desert
Public Arts Program
October 2006

As part of the Public Arts Program, the city of Palm Desert placed this sculpture outside of their newly built Visitor's Center, a green building. Since the sculpture is made of recycled materials, the City felt that "the palm represented the spirit of the building".

HGTV Crafters Coast to Coast

Crafters Coast to Coast
November 2004

Sol Mesz swears she woke up one day while working in the world of marketing and decided, "I want to weld." In the process... read the full article and see images from the show.

Crafters Coast to Coast is a TV program that airs nationwide on HGTV cable channel. Initial airing of the show was November 2004, and is re-played frequently.
